Aaron Talks About His Second ‘Shark Tank’ Appearance and Rejection

Tiege Hanley Vlog: Aaron Is Going Back on ‘Shark Tank’

On this installment of the “Starting a Business and Building a Brand” video series, Aaron makes a big announcement—he’ll be appearing on season 7 (episode 29) of “Shark Tank” to pitch his award-winning men’s hair styling line Pete & Pedro. Aaron says he filmed the episode nearly a year ago, and it’s been the single-hardest secret he’s ever had to keep.

How to Handle Rejection as an Entrepreneur

As you may know, Aaron previously appeared on “Shark Tank” (season 4, episode 2) to pitch the investors his Alpha M Style System. After walking away with—spoiler alert!—no deal, Aaron learned a few important lessons but ultimately experienced what he calls “heartbreaking rejection.” At the end of the experience, Aaron knew he had to lower the price of the system and convert it to a digital format for it to be successful.

Aaron says it was this feedback that led him to create Pete & Pedro, a low-priced hair product line that a lot of guys need and want. As soon as he launched Pete & Pedro, Aaron knew that he had to take his new product into the Tank and get it in front of the sharks. Aaron closes the video by encouraging budding entrepreneurs to use negative feedback to forge a successful company.

So Did Aaron Make a Deal on ‘Shark Tank?’

SPOILER: At the time of this vlog, Aaron was unable to share the results of his Pete & Pedro pitch, but the show has now aired and you can watch the episode here. After entertaining multiple deals, Aaron ultimately agreed to do a deal with Barbara Corcoran. In the end, the deal fell through.
